Top 5 PVP Games in the US: Q3 2022 Performance Overview
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 PVP games in the US during Q3 2022, covering metrics like we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2022, the top 5 PVP games in the United States showcased notable trends in their performance metrics. Here's a detailed look at how each game fared during this period,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Roblox saw its weekly revenue peak at around $8.5M at the end of June, experiencing a gradual decline to approximately $7.3M by the end of September. Weekly downloads showed a downward trend, starting at over 600K in late June and dropping to around 390K by the end of the quarter. Meanwhile, active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 23M and 25M throughout the quarter.
Coin Master maintained a steady weekly revenue, fluctuating between $4.4M and $4.9M. Downloads saw a slight decline from around 146K in late June to about 87K by the end of September. Active users also displayed a downward trend, starting at over 860K and ending the quarter at approximately 670K.
Pokémon GO experienced varying weekly revenue, peaking at about $5.8M in late August before dropping to around $3.4M by mid-September. Downloads remained relatively stable, averaging around 150K per week. The game’s active users hovered between 15M and 16M, with a slight decrease towards the end of the quarter.
Evony showed consistent weekly revenue, ranging from $3.9M to $4.4M. Downloads were relatively stable, with a peak of over 200K in early August and ending the quarter at around 143K. Active users remained steady, fluctuating between 714K and 784K over the quarter.
Bingo Blitz™ - BINGO Games had weekly revenue ranging from $3.4M to $3.9M. Downloads saw a gradual increase, peaking at around 54K in mid-September. Active users increased slightly from about 290K in late June to over 320K by mid-September, before stabilizing at around 294K towards the end of the quarter.
